Original Description
Jiang Shijie's Landscape (album W/8 Works) is a captivating exploration of traditional Chinese ink aesthetics reinvigorated with contemporary sensibility. The album presents eight meticulously composed landscapes, where mist-shrouded mountains dissolve into fluid brushstrokes, and sparse yet deliberate detailing suggests vastness rather than defines it. Executed in ink on paper, Jiang’s technique pays homage to Song Dynasty literati traditions—particularly the shan-shui (mountain-water) genre’s philosophical depth—while embracing modernist abstraction through nuanced tonal gradations and asymmetric balance. Active in the late 20th century, Jiang belonged to a generation reconciling Cultural Revolution-era disruptions with China’s artistic legacy; his works bridge historical reverence and subtle experimentation. Unlike the politicized art of his peers, Landscape prioritizes meditative harmony, earning acclaim for revitalizing ink painting’s poetic potential amid globalized art trends. Today, the album is regarded as a touchstone for Neo-ink practitioners, demonstrating how classical idioms can resonate in contemporary contexts.
